Neurological Surgery in Rhode Island
37 providers, $607,134 in total reported payments from drug and device makers. Ranked below by lifetime general payments. The median provider in this group received $2,683.
Ranking high here usually means a consulting or royalty arrangement, not wrongdoing. Payments to device inventors and trial investigators are legal, disclosed, and concentrated in a small number of people — which is exactly why a list like this has a steep top and a long flat tail.
What Medicare pays neurological surgery clinicians in Rhode Island
Across 22 neurological surgery clinicians in Rhode Island who billed Original Medicare Part B in 2024, Medicare allowed $1,660,709 in total — an average of $75,487 each, of which $75,487 was for services and the rest for drugs administered in the office.
This is not a salary. The rest is what Medicare allowed for services these clinicians billed — Original Medicare fee-for-service only. It excludes Medicare Advantage, which now covers more than half of Medicare enrollees, along with Medicaid and every commercial insurer, so for most clinicians it is a fraction of their practice. It is also gross revenue: staff, rent, supplies and malpractice premiums all come out of it before anyone is paid. Anyone quoting a figure like this as physician pay is misreading it.
